Sourcing guidance for Whisk Broom

What are the key material specifications to consider when sourcing whisk brooms for different usage scenarios?

For industrial or heavy-duty cleaning, prioritize natural corn husks or stiff sorghum fibers as they offer superior durability and abrasive power. For household or delicate surfaces, soft synthetic bristles (PBT or PET) are preferred to prevent scratching. Ensure the handle material (wood, plastic, or bamboo) is ergonomically designed and treated with a moisture-resistant coating to prevent rot or cracking during long-term storage.

What quality standards and certifications should a B2B buyer verify for whisk brooms?

Buyers should look for ISO 9001 certification to ensure consistent manufacturing processes. If sourcing natural fiber brooms, verify FSC (Forest Stewardship Council) certification for sustainable wood/bamboo components. For food-service environments, ensure the materials are BPA-free and comply with FDA or EU food-contact regulations. Additionally, check for tensile strength reports on the binding wire or twine to ensure bristles do not shed prematurely.

How can I evaluate the durability and construction quality of a whisk broom before bulk purchasing?

Focus on the binding technique; high-quality whisk brooms use triple-stitched nylon thread or galvanized steel wire to secure the shoulders. Request a shedding test report or a sample to perform a 'pull test' on the bristles. For plastic variants, ensure the injection molding is free of burrs and that the bristle density is high enough to capture fine dust particles in a single pass.

What are the economic feasibility factors when ordering whisk brooms in large volumes?

To optimize Total Cost of Ownership (TCO), aim for a Minimum Order Quantity (MOQ) that triggers a 15-25% price break, typically at the 5,000-unit level. Consider flat-pack shipping options where handles and heads are assembled at the destination to reduce volumetric freight costs. Always factor in customs duties specific to 'brooms and brushes' (HS Code 960310) for your target country.

Cross-Border Procurement Strategy & Risk Management

What are the primary risks when importing whisk brooms and how can they be mitigated?

The main risk is biological contamination in natural fibers (e.g., pests or mold). Mitigate this by requiring a Fumigation Certificate and a Phytosanitary Certificate from the supplier before shipment. How should I negotiate with suppliers to ensure long-term quality stability?

Negotiate a Quality Assurance Agreement (QAA) that specifies a Defect Rate of less than 1%. Request that the supplier provides Pre-Shipment Inspection (PSI) photos and videos. For repeat orders, negotiate staggered payment terms (e.g., 30% deposit, 70% after inspection but before shipping) to maintain leverage over product consistency.

What logistics and shipping methods are best for delivering whisk brooms to international markets?

Due to the relatively low value-to-volume ratio, Sea Freight (LCL or FCL) is the most cost-effective method. For high-end or customized retail whisk brooms, Rail Freight (for Eurasia) offers a balance between speed and cost. Ensure the packaging uses double-walled corrugated boxes with desiccant silica gel packs to prevent moisture damage during transit across different climate zones.
